引言
在图形绘制领域,弧度是一个常用的概念,尤其在绘制曲线、圆形或弧形时。半个弧度是弧度的一种,它指的是圆周上的一段,其长度等于圆的半径。本文将揭秘半个弧度的绘制技巧,帮助您轻松掌握画图小秘密。
一、什么是半个弧度?
1.1 弧度的定义
弧度是角度的一种度量单位,用于描述圆上的一段弧长与半径的比例。具体来说,一个完整圆的周长是2πr(r为半径),因此一个完整圆的弧度是2π。
1.2 半个弧度的计算
半个弧度即为1/2个完整圆的弧度,计算公式为:πr/2。
二、半个弧度的绘制方法
2.1 使用绘图软件
许多绘图软件都提供了绘制弧度的功能,例如Adobe Illustrator、CorelDRAW等。以下是使用这些软件绘制半个弧度的基本步骤:
- 打开绘图软件,创建一个新的画布。
- 使用椭圆工具或圆工具绘制一个圆。
- 选择弧度工具,设置弧度类型为“半圆”。
- 在圆上拖动鼠标,绘制出半个弧度。
2.2 使用编程语言
如果您熟悉编程,可以使用编程语言绘制半个弧度。以下是一些常用的编程语言及其绘制半个弧度的示例:
2.2.1 Python(使用matplotlib库)
import matplotlib.pyplot as plt
import numpy as np
# 创建一个半径为r的圆
r = 5
theta = np.linspace(0, np.pi, 100) # 半个圆的弧度
x = r * np.cos(theta)
y = r * np.sin(theta)
# 绘制半个圆
plt.plot(x, y)
plt.axis('equal')
plt.show()
2.2.2 JavaScript(使用HTML5 canvas)
<!DOCTYPE html>
<html>
<head>
<title>半个弧度绘制</title>
</head>
<body>
<canvas id="canvas" width="400" height="400"></canvas>
<script>
var canvas = document.getElementById('canvas');
var ctx = canvas.getContext('2d');
var r = 200; // 半径
var theta = Math.PI; // 半个圆的弧度
ctx.beginPath();
ctx.arc(200, 200, r, 0, theta);
ctx.stroke();
</script>
</body>
</html>
三、半个弧度的应用场景
3.1 图形设计
在图形设计中,半个弧度常用于绘制圆角矩形、圆角按钮等元素。
3.2 建筑设计
在建筑设计中,半个弧度可用于绘制弧形窗、弧形门等。
3.3 机械设计
在机械设计中,半个弧度可用于绘制齿轮、凸轮等零件。
四、总结
半个弧度是图形绘制中常用的概念,本文介绍了半个弧度的定义、绘制方法和应用场景。通过学习本文,您将轻松掌握半个弧度的绘制技巧,为您的绘图工作带来便利。
